I have the CheapHeat and have been using it every night as it gets cold in the PalmSprings area at night lately. Works great! Per digital readout it is drawing 22amps on each leg. Have not touched the propane tanks for months. Cook with propane and when doing back to back showers we turn on the propane water heater.
No CHEAP potentially dangerous little heaters to deal with. Set the T Stat and enjoy.
Well worth the investment.
